TL-SL5428E 24-port 10/100Mbps + 4-port Gigabit L2 Managed Switch CLI Guide Chapter 13 ARP Inspection Commands ARP (Address Resolution Protocol) Detect function is to protect the switch from the ARP cheating, such as the Network Gateway Spoofing and Man-In-The-Middle Attack, etc. arp detection (global) Description The arp detection (global) command is used to enable the ARP Detection function globally. To disable the ARP Detection function, please use no arp detection command. Syntax arp detection no arp detection Command Mode Global Configuration Mode Example Enable the ARP Detection function globally: TP-LINK(config)# arp detection arp detection trust-port Description The arp detection trust-port command is used to configure the port for which the ARP Detect function is unnecessary as the Trusted Port. To clear the Trusted Port list, please use no arp detection trust-port command .The specific ports, such as up-linked port, routing port and LAG port, should be set as Trusted Port. To ensure the normal communication of the switch, please configure the ARP Trusted Port before enabling the ARP Detect function. Syntax arp detection trust-port port-list no arp detection trust-port 69
